Abstract

The invention discloses a vibrating device used for a building concrete pouring process. The vibrating device comprises a form, an extension plate, a moving support and a moving wheel set. Under the arrangement of a driving assembly, a rotating rod and a material receiving plate work synchronously, concrete residues adhered to the outer surface of vibrating rods can fall onto the material receiving plate below in the retreating process of the vibrating rods, and cannot be scattered to next area or even trowelling area, the residues are collected in a centralized manner, the vibrating rods are inserted, meanwhile, the material receiving plate retreats, reusing is achieved, manual repeated repair is not needed, meanwhile, resource waste is avoided; under the arrangement of a trowelling box body, the movable support, the vibrating rods and a vibrating motor, vibrating and trowelling integration is achieved; under the arrangement of an air cylinder, a first frame body, a first pin shaft, an anti-sticking soil sliding plate and a driven driving assembly, the guide effect on the collected residues is achieved, and the efficiency that the residues flow to the interior of the trowelling box body to be collected is accelerated; and meanwhile, after machining is completed, the piston rod is shrunk to enable the material receiving plate to incline towards the left lower portion, and then the collected residues can be intensively and efficiently dumped.

Description

technical field [0001] The invention relates to the technical field of building construction equipment, in particular to a vibrating device used in the building concrete pouring process. Background technique [0002] After the concrete pouring is completed, it is necessary to vibrate the poured concrete to make the concrete densely bonded, eliminate the phenomenon of concrete honeycomb pockmarks, etc., so as to improve its strength and ensure the quality of concrete components. [0003] Existing vibrating devices such as row-type vibrating machines can only achieve a single vibrating work, and the subsequent smoothing work needs to be removed to replace the equipment and re-smoothed, which is inefficient; or after the vibration is completed, manual hand-held Troweling equipment for troweling.
